Description

Accelerating the development, commercialization and scaling of innovative climate solutions is increasingly recognized as critical to achieving sustainable and inclusive industrial development in developing countries. As highlighted in the United Nations Industrial Development Organization (UNIDO)’s Industrial Development Report 2026, climate innovation is essential to driving growth, job creation and socio-economic resilience through decarbonized industrial systems across sectors such as manufacturing, transport, power and buildings. This is particularly important in developing countries, where much of the world’s future industrial growth is expected to take place and where innovative and transformational projects can enable system-wide transitions towards low-emission development pathways.

At the same time, many of the technologies needed to achieve global climate targets are not yet fully commercialized. The International Energy Agency (IEA) estimates that approximately 35% of the emissions reductions required to achieve a global net-zero scenario by 2050 will need to come from technologies that are currently at the demonstration or prototype stage. This underscores the urgent need to accelerate the commercialization and scaling of innovative climate solutions and “lighthouse” demonstration projects that validate technical and commercial feasibility, reduce investment risks and catalyse broader replication and deployment.
